Alice L Walton School of Medicine Establishing a school of medicine offering a four-year, medical degree-granting program that integrates conventional medicine with holistic principles and self-care practices, and carrying out related activities promoting whole health practices.
Alice L Walton School of Medicine has received 5 grants from 2 known foundation funders. Revenue increased from $10,890,974 in 2022 to $272,971,712 in 2023. Most recent reported revenue: $272,971,712.

Financial History
| Year | Revenue | Expenses | Assets |
|---|---|---|---|
| 2023 | $272,971,712 | $22,151,638 | $291,058,375 |
| 2022 | $10,890,974 | $11,536,757 | $3,481,306 |
| 2021 | $8,252,593 | $5,214,683 | $3,764,364 |
| 2020 | $1,407,000 | $1,319,379 | $327,050 |
